HVAC Maintenance in Canyon Lake, TX: What to Expect
Living along the I-35 corridor between Austin and San Antonio, Canyon Lake residents endure roughly 110 days each year with temperatures exceeding 90 degrees, paired with the persistent humidity that defines Central Texas summers. This climate punishes cooling equipment relentlessly, demanding far more from residential systems than the simple on-off cycles seen in drier regions. The combination of extended cooling seasons and high latent load creates year-round wear that makes routine service essential rather than optional. Transparency in pricing helps homeowners plan for system longevity. A single AC tune-up typically runs $70 to $200, while furnace maintenance falls in the $80 to $220 range, and a comprehensive full HVAC inspection that evaluates both heating and cooling components generally costs $150 to $400. Texas law adds an important safeguard: contractors must hold either a Class A unlimited license or a Class B license from the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ation, qualifying them to service cooling systems up to 25 tons and heating equipment up to 1.5 million BTU per hour. This licensing structure ensures that whoever arrives at your door possesses the technical credentials to diagnose issues accurately and recommend repairs that actually address the problem.
